Q: Is 989,497 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 989,497 is a composite number.

Why is 989,497 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 989,497 can be evenly divided by 1 97 101 9,797 10,201 and 989,497, with no remainder.

Since 989,497 cannot be divided by just 1 and 989,497, it is a composite number.
